如何删除购物车数据库

如何删除购物车数据库

要删除购物车数据库,你需要备份数据、确保没有其他系统依赖、选择合适的删除方法、进行彻底的数据库清理。 其中,备份数据是最重要的一步,因为它可以防止数据意外丢失导致无法恢复的问题。即使你确定要删除数据库,备份数据还是一个良好的习惯,尤其是在处理敏感信息时。接下来,将详细描述如何安全地删除购物车数据库。


一、备份数据

在删除任何数据库之前,备份数据是一个必不可少的步骤。备份可以确保在意外删除或数据损坏的情况下,数据仍然可以恢复。

1、选择备份工具

有多种数据库备份工具可供选择,如mysqldump、pg_dump等。选择合适的工具取决于你所使用的数据库类型。

2、执行备份

执行备份时,确保所有数据,包括表结构和数据内容,都被完整地备份。例如,使用MySQL时,可以通过以下命令备份数据库:

mysqldump -u username -p database_name > backup.sql

3、验证备份

备份完成后,验证备份文件是否完整和可用。可以通过恢复备份到一个临时数据库中,检查数据是否正确。

二、确保没有其他系统依赖

在删除购物车数据库之前,必须确认没有其他系统或应用程序依赖于该数据库。

1、检查系统依赖

检查系统中所有与购物车相关的功能模块,确保它们都不再需要访问该数据库。

2、通知相关团队

通知所有相关团队,包括开发团队和运维团队,确保他们了解数据库即将被删除,并确认没有任何依赖。

三、选择合适的删除方法

根据不同的需求,选择合适的删除方法。常见的删除方法包括:

1、直接删除数据库

如果确定数据库不再使用,可以直接删除数据库。例如,在MySQL中,可以使用以下命令删除数据库:

DROP DATABASE database_name;

2、逐步删除表和数据

如果不确定是否完全删除数据库,可以逐步删除表和数据,确保没有遗漏。例如:

DROP TABLE table_name;

3、禁用数据库

另一种方法是先禁用数据库,确保在一定时间内没有任何应用程序访问,然后再删除。例如,通过更改数据库配置文件,将其设为只读模式。

四、彻底清理数据库

删除数据库后,需要进行彻底的清理工作,以确保系统的完整性和安全性。

1、清理缓存和临时文件

清理所有与数据库相关的缓存和临时文件,确保没有残留数据。例如,删除缓存目录中的文件:

rm -rf /path/to/cache/*

2、更新配置文件

更新系统配置文件,移除所有与购物车数据库相关的配置项,确保系统不再试图访问已删除的数据库。

3、监控系统状态

删除数据库后,监控系统状态,确保没有任何错误或异常出现。如果发现问题,及时进行处理。

五、推荐项目管理系统

在处理数据库删除过程中,项目管理系统可以帮助你更好地协调团队工作,确保任务顺利完成。以下是两个推荐的项目管理系统:

1、研发项目管理系统PingCode

PingCode是一款专为研发团队设计的项目管理系统,提供了强大的任务管理、版本控制和代码审查功能,帮助团队高效协作。

2、通用项目协作软件Worktile

Worktile是一款通用的项目协作软件,适用于各种规模的团队,提供了任务分配、进度跟踪和团队沟通等多种功能,帮助团队提高工作效率。


通过备份数据、确保没有系统依赖、选择合适的删除方法和进行彻底的数据库清理,你可以安全地删除购物车数据库。同时,使用项目管理系统PingCode和Worktile,可以帮助你更好地协调团队工作,确保任务顺利完成。

相关问答FAQs:

1. 我如何清空购物车数据库?

  • 首先,您需要登录到购物车数据库的管理平台或使用数据库管理工具。
  • 找到购物车数据库的表或集合,这是存储购物车数据的地方。
  • 使用SQL查询或工具提供的功能,执行删除操作来清空购物车数据。
  • 在执行删除操作之前,确保您备份了购物车数据,以防止意外删除。

2. 如何删除购物车数据库中的特定项目?

  • 首先,您需要知道要删除的项目的唯一标识符或特定字段值。
  • 使用SQL查询或工具提供的筛选功能,根据项目的标识符或字段值来选择要删除的项目。
  • 确保在执行删除操作之前,备份购物车数据库,以防止意外删除。
  • 执行删除操作后,确认所选项目已从购物车数据库中删除。

3. 如何删除购物车数据库并重建一个新的数据库?

  • 首先,您需要备份现有的购物车数据库,以防止数据丢失。
  • 使用数据库管理工具或平台提供的功能,删除现有的购物车数据库。
  • 创建一个新的购物车数据库,可以使用相同的名称或选择一个新的名称。
  • 在新的购物车数据库中,使用SQL查询或工具提供的功能来创建必要的表或集合以存储购物车数据。
  • 如果需要,将备份的数据导入新的购物车数据库中,以恢复之前的购物车数据。

原创文章,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/1913665

(0)
Edit2Edit2
上一篇 4天前
下一篇 4天前
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部